I attended American River Junior College in Sacramento, California, then went to Brigham Young University in Provo, Utah. After serving a two year mission for the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ints (Mormon), I attended the College of Physicians and Surgeons (Now University of the Pacific) in San Francisco California. I graduated third person from the top of my class in 1966. My average score on the National Dental Boards was in the 92nd percentile. 

I passed the California State Dental Board and practiced in Pleasanton California for ten years, leaving there in 1966. After passing the New Mexico State Dental Examining Board, my family and I moved to Corrales, New Mexico in 1976. I have been practicing at my present location at 3613 NM HWY 528, suite G, Albuquerque for the last 23 years.

Professional Associations and Organizations 

I have been a member of the American Dental Association for thirty-three years, and have been a member of the Albuquerque Dental Society for twenty-three years. I have also been a member of the Academy of General Dentistry, an organization that promotes continuing education in all areas of general dentistry, for over 25 years. I have been a member of the Academy of LDS Dentists, a service and educational organization, for five years.
